Leadership Team



Tiger Tang, M.D.
Dr. Tang has over 20-years’ experiences of R&D, investment, and commercial operation in medical device industry. Before starting Tiger Lifescience Inc., he did research and teaching in cardiovascular field in Sun Yat-sen University for more than ten years and worked for Baxter and Edwards Lifesciences as Senior Marketing and Sales Director. He successfully opened up early medical device disposables market in China. He also owns successful entrepreneurial experiences in medical device industry. Dr. Tang graduated from Xiangya Medical University and Sun Yat-sen University of Medical Sciences.
Jenny Jiang, M.D. MBA
Dr. Jenny holds an MBA degree from Stanford University and a medical doctorate degree from Sun Yat-sen University. Before starting Tiger Lifescience, she worked for Johnson & Johnson in US and China. Jenny also has rich experience in academia and successfully commercialized innovative technologies as she worked at South China University of Technology as a lecturer and as a founder of her first startup over ten years ago. In addition, Jenny has rich entrepreneurial experience as well as multi-national managerial skills. She is very insightful in biotech industry along with medical devices.
Yina Tang, M.S.
Yina holds a Master’s degree of Finance from John Hopkins University and Bachelor’s degree of of Finance and Economics from Washington University in St. Louis. Before Joining Tiger Lifescience Inc., she worked as financial analyst for Morgan Stanley, Security analyst for Wells Fargo and accountant for World Trade Center Institute. Yina has rich finance and accounting experiences and she is good at financial analysis for medical industry, corporate financial planning, IPO, M&A and risk control.
Advisors


Michael Jin, PhD
Michael holds Ph.D./M.Sc. degrees in Electrical Engineering from Stanford University, California and B.Eng./M.Eng. degrees in Biomedical Engineering from Tsinghua University, Beijing.
Michael Jin is a Managing Director who serves as the BioMed Group Lead at TEEC Angel Fund. Michael leads the analysis and execution of investment in startups in both US and China with focus on biomedicine, semiconductor, and clean-tech.
Michael Zhong, Ph.D. MBA
Dr. Zhong has more than twenty years' experiences in venture capital investment, management consulting, scientific research, business development and operation. Dr. Zhong is the leader of Techcode US Medtech Accelerator and supervising global Medtech acceleration program for Techcode. Before Techcode, Dr. Zhong worked for DFJ ePlanet Ventures as China investment head and PwC as senior business manager.
Dr. Michael Zhong holds a PhD. degree in chemistry from Stanford University and MBA from UC Berkley HAAS Business School.
